Description

Final Fantasy III delivers a timeless role‑playing experience, featuring a robust job system that lets players customize their party's abilities. The story follows four heroes on a quest to restore balance to a world threatened by darkness. The 2006 remake enhances the original with vibrant graphics, refined turn‑based combat, and expanded side quests, offering both nostalgic fans and new players an engaging adventure across an open world.

The Witcher 3: Wild Hunt is a story-driven open-world RPG in which you play Geralt of Rivia, a monster hunter searching for his adopted daughter. It is celebrated for its mature writing, meaningful side quests, and a massive, hand-crafted world.
